Que ventajas puede ofrecer los proyectos Web de ASP NET MVC?

¿Qué ventajas puede ofrecer los proyectos Web de ASP NET MVC?

Las principales ventajas de ASP.net MVC son:

  • Permite el control total sobre el HTML renderizado.
  • Proporciona una clara separación de preocupaciones (SoC).
  • Habilita el Test Driven Development (TDD) .
  • Fácil integración con marcos de JavaScript.
  • Siguiendo el diseño de la naturaleza sin estado de la web.

¿Qué es Microsoft ASP NET MVC 2?

ASP.NET MVC Framework es un marco de trabajo cuya segunda versión ha visto la luz en marzo de este año. Ha sido creado por Microsoft con objeto de ayudarnos a desarrollar aplicaciones que sigan la filosofía MVC sobre ASP.NET.

¿Cómo depurar ASP?

Seleccione el proyecto de ASP.NET Core en el Explorador de soluciones de Visual Studio y haga clic en el icono Propiedades, presione Alt+Entrar o haga clic con el botón derecho y seleccione Propiedades. Seleccione la pestaña Depurar.

LEA TAMBIÉN:   Cuando se actualiza el score?

¿Cómo funciona una aplicación MVC?

Arquitectura de aplicaciones MVC

  1. El usuario realiza una solicitud a nuestro sitio web.
  2. El controlador comunica tanto con modelos como con vistas.
  3. Para producir la salida, en ocasiones las vistas pueden solicitar más información a los modelos.
  4. Las vistas envían al usuario la salida.

¿Por qué es importante el MVC?

¿Por qué utilizar MVC? Porque es un patrón de diseño de software probado y se sabe que funciona. Con MVC la aplicación se puede desarrollar rápidamente, de forma modular y mantenible. Separar las funciones de la aplicación en modelos, vistas y controladores hace que la aplicación sea muy ligera.

¿Quién creó el ASP?

ASP.NET
Tipo de programa Framework
Desarrollador Microsoft
Lanzamiento inicial enero de 2003
Licencia EULA

¿Qué es el MVC 4?

En modelo de programación ASP.NET MVC 4 es la opción por la que más están optando las empresas a la hora de abordar nuevos proyectos de desarrollo web. ASP.NET MVC está basado en el conocido patrón de diseño Model View Controller. Adentrarse en el manejo de datos con tecnologías avanzadas como Entity Framework.

¿Cómo crear una aplicación web en MVC?

Asigne al proyecto el nombre «MvcMovie» y, después, elija Aceptar. En el cuadro de diálogo nueva aplicación Web de ASP.net , elija MVC y, a continuación, elija Aceptar.

LEA TAMBIÉN:   Donde ver las estrellas en Los Angeles?

¿Cómo conectar la base de datos a MVC Music Store?

Compruebe la conexión a la base de datos. Para ello, haga doble clic en MvcMusicStore. MDF para establecer una conexión. Conexión a MvcMusicStore. MDF En esta tarea, creará un modelo de datos para interactuar con la base de datos agregada en la tarea anterior. Cree un modelo de datos que represente la base de datos.

¿Cómo Iniciar una aplicación en Visual Studio?

Se trata de una «Hola mundo» simple. Project, y es un buen lugar para iniciar la aplicación. Presiona F5 para iniciar la depuración. Cuando presione F5, Visual Studio se iniciará IIS Express y ejecutará la aplicación Web. A continuación, Visual Studio inicia un explorador y abre la Página principal de la aplicación.

¿Dónde se registran las rutas en MVC?

Las rutas de la aplicación deben estar definidas justo antes de poder recibir cualquier petición. Es por ello que, de forma predeterminada, el registro de rutas se lleva a cabo en el archivo Global. asax.

¿Qué es routing en MVC?

El Routing es la funcionalidad de una aplicación MVC que indica que vistas tienen que ser manejadas por un determinado controlador. El routing nos permite personalizar esta ruta para introducir nuevos parámetros o URL`s en el controlador.

LEA TAMBIÉN:   Que hace el cloroplasto en las plantas?

¿Cómo hacer una API REST C#?

Para crear una API Rest en C# es muy sencillo, únicamente debemos crear un nuevo proyecto web. Y como tipo, escogemos API, podemos elegir tanto vacío (empty) como aplicación web (web application) o incluso web application (MVC) la única diferencia es que vienen con más o menos funcionalidades por defecto.

¿Qué es MVC 5?

Modelo Vista Controlador (MVC) es un estilo de arquitectura de software que separa los datos de una aplicación, la interfaz de usuario, y la lógica de control en tres componentes distintos. La Vista, o interfaz de usuario, que compone la información que se envía al cliente y los mecanismos interacción con éste.

¿Qué problema resuelve el patrón MVC?

Usualmente, el mayor desafío del MVC consiste en determinar la base; es decir, definir interfaces adecuadas para que interactúen modelo, vistas y controlador. A menudo, como en la mayor parte del software, un elemento MVC se desarrolla para satisfacer un conjunto específico de necesidades.